Third-party recovery services promising to bypass security protocols should be avoided entirely. These often operate scams – professional data forensics cannot reconstruct cryptographic secrets generated by true random number generation. The only legitimate solution involves creating a new wallet with fresh credentials and migrating holdings manually.
For devices still operational but lacking backup documentation:
1. Generate a fresh wallet on alternate hardware or through reputable software options like Electrum or Mycelium
2. Initiate transfers in small test amounts first to verify destination address accuracy
3. Document the new backup materials on archival-grade paper or metal plates stored separately
4. Wipe the original device completely after confirming successful migration
Prevent recurrence by implementing redundant backup strategies immediately:
– Split phrases using Shamir’s Secret Sharing for distributed storage
– Encrypt digital copies with strong passwords if opting for electronic storage
– Store physical copies in geographically separate secure locations like safety deposit boxes

Hardware wallets like Trezor intentionally design their systems to prevent unauthorized access, meaning there’s no built-in “backdoor” to bypass this requirement. If you’ve misplaced your backup phrase, your primary option is to ensure you still have the device itself and its PIN, which grants temporary access to your funds.
If you’ve stored your crypto in a hardware wallet and no longer have the backup phrase, you can transfer your assets to a new wallet while the device is accessible. First, set up a new hardware or software wallet, generate a new backup phrase, and securely store it. Then, use the original device to send your funds to the new wallet’s address. However, this process requires the device to be functional and accessible via its PIN.
In cases where the device is lost or damaged, and the backup phrase is unavailable, the funds are effectively irretrievable. Yes, a hardware wallet can be reused if you no longer have access to the original backup phrase. However, this requires resetting the device to factory settings and generating a new set of cryptographic keys.
When you initialize the wallet again, it will produce a fresh backup phrase. This new phrase becomes the sole method for restoring access to any funds stored on the device moving forward.
Before performing a reset, ensure all existing funds are transferred to another wallet or exchanged into fiat currency. Once the device is reset, previous addresses and private keys linked to the old backup phrase are permanently erased.
Most hardware wallets, like Ledger or KeepKey, provide clear instructions for resetting in their official documentation. Follow these steps carefully to avoid errors during the process.
After setting up the wallet with a new backup phrase, test the restoration process by importing the phrase into compatible software. This step confirms the integrity of the new setup.
Reusing a hardware wallet without the original backup phrase securely erases previous data. However, failure to transfer funds beforehand results in irreversible loss of access to those assets.

No, Trezor cannot recover your wallet or funds if you lose the recovery seed. Unlike online services, hardware wallets like Trezor rely entirely on the recovery seed for backup. If lost, even Trezor support cannot restore access to your wallet. The only way to regain access is by using the original recovery seed.
If you still have the Trezor device and remember the PIN, transfer your funds to a new wallet immediately. Set up a new Trezor or another hardware wallet, generate a new recovery seed, and move your crypto assets there. Do not delay—if the device is lost or damaged afterward, your funds will be inaccessible.
No, a 12 or 24-word recovery seed has an astronomically high number of possible combinations, making brute-forcing impractical. Even with immense computing power, guessing the correct sequence would take thousands of years. Properly stored backups are the only reliable solution.
Yes, anyone with access to your recovery seed can control your wallet and steal your funds. If you suspect your seed was exposed, move your assets to a new wallet immediately. Never share the seed or store it digitally (e.g., photos or cloud storage).
Trezor does not store or have access to your recovery seed. Their hardware wallets are designed to keep full control in your hands. No exceptions exist—once the seed is lost, only a previously made backup can restore access.
